Sanut will host the fifth edition of “A la granja, sin salir de la ciudad” this weekend, offering families a free, educational farm experience in the capital. The event runs Saturday 15 and Sunday 16, from 10:00 a.m. to 5:00 p.m., at the Agrotienda Sanut patio on the Duarte highway (kilometer 10½), with free entry for all .
Visitors can interact with farm animals, join guided tours, and learn about Dominican agricultural production processes. The program aims to promote food education, respect for nature, and appreciation of local producers .
Alma Lajara, Sanut's brand manager, said the initiative has become a space to strengthen family bonds and spark children's curiosity about where food comes from. “We want families to enjoy together and children to discover, in a practical and entertaining way, how food travels from the field to their tables,” she said .
